According to the Low Dose Naltrexone home page [LDN], Transverse Myelitis
is a neurodegenerative disease that is associated with autoimmune processes.
LDN has been seen to benefit Transverse Myelitis.
[LDN] reports that all patients with Transverse Myelitis whom the late
Dr. Bihari [Bihari2003] treated using LDN
"have experienced a halt in progression of their illness.
In many patients there was a marked remission in signs and symptoms of the disease."
